Are to Square Inch Conversion Formula

To convert from Are (a) to Square Inch (in2), use the following formula:

Square Inch (in2)

= 100 × 10.7639 × 144× Are (a)

= 155000.16× Are (a)

With 10.7639 is the ratio between the base units Square Foot (ft2) and Square Meter (m2).


Example

Let's convert 5 Are (a) to Square Inch (in2).

Using the formula:

5 × 155000.16 = 775000.8

Therefore, 5 Are (a) is equal to 775000.8 Square Inch (in2).

How many ares are in one square inch? One Square Inch (in2) contains 0.0000064516062435032325128 Ares (a) — the inverse of the factor above. Multiplying by 155000.16 takes you from ares to square inches; multiplying by 0.0000064516062435032325128 brings you back.

Put in words: one are equals 155000.16 square inches, so the are is the larger unit of this pair. Converting between them never changes the amount of area being measured — only the size of the unit you count it in.

What is an Are (a)?

An are (a) is a metric unit of area, defined as 100 square meters (100 m2).

It is part of the same system as the more widely known hectare. The plural form is ares.


From Are to Hectare: A Common Land Measurement

The hectare (ha), a much more common unit for measuring land, is derived directly from the are.

The prefix 'hecto-' means 100, so one hectare is equal to 100 ares.

Since one are is 100 square meters, a hectare is equivalent to 10,000 square meters (100 ares × 100 m2/are). This makes the hectare an ideal unit for measuring large areas, such as farms, forests, and parks.


The History and Modern Use of the Are

The are was first established as part of the original French metric system in 1795. It was designed to serve as a standard base unit for measuring land, simplifying calculations required by older, traditional units.

While the hectare is more common today in agriculture and forestry, the are is still used in specific contexts, such as real estate and land registries in many countries, particularly throughout Europe.


The are serves as the foundation for other metric units of land area, making conversions straightforward. The most common related units include:

  • Centiare (ca): Equal to one-hundredth of an are. This makes a centiare precisely one square meter (1 m2).
  • Decare (daa): Equal to ten ares, or 1,000 square meters (1,000 m2). The decare is often used for land measurement in parts of Eastern Europe and the Middle East.
  • Hectare (ha): Equal to one hundred ares, or 10,000 square meters (10,000 m2).

What is a Square Inch (in2)?

A square inch (in2) is a standard unit of area in the imperial system, most commonly used in the United States.

To put it simply, it's the area of a square that measures one inch on each side.

For a larger comparison, it is equal to 1/144th of a square foot (ft2).


The square inch plays a vital role in one of the most commonly used pressure measurements: Pounds per Square Inch (PSI).

This unit is essential in everyday life, such as when inflating car tires or measuring water pressure in plumbing systems.

Simply put, PSI indicates the amount of force applied to a single square inch of area. This measurement is crucial for ensuring safety and optimal performance in various applications.


Converting Square Inches

Since most of the world uses the metric system, it's essential to know key conversions.

For instance, one square inch is exactly 6.4516 square centimeters (cm2).

This conversion is essential for global fields like trade, scientific research, and manufacturing. As a real-world reference, a US postage stamp measures about one square inch.


Common Uses of the Square Inch Today

While larger areas are measured in square feet or acres, the square inch remains the standard for specifying smaller surfaces.

It's commonly used in:

  • Material Science: Measuring fabric density, such as threads per square inch.
  • Printing & Digital Imaging: Defining resolution with standards like Dots Per Inch (DPI), which is often measured over a square inch.
  • Electronics & Hardware: Specifying the size of small electronic components, hardware, and fasteners.
  • Small-Scale Construction: Detailing requirements for materials like tiles or fittings.
